SOME Lusaka residents have appreciated the ongoing voter registration taking place in Shoprite stores. The Electoral Commission of Zambia (ECZ) recently announced a partnership with Shoprite Zambia that will see Shoprite stores across the country serve as voter registration points during the 15-day extension period. A check by News Diggers found the process of voter registration at the Shoprite branches in Kalingalinga, Cairo and Manda Hill going well. A shopper at the Kalingalinga branch said registering at Shoprite is ideal, as people can register while doing their shopping. “It’s easier for people to come and register because it’s everywhere.
